Michael Phelps's name is well known even for those who don't follow swimming events. He's another sport legend that made history as he's the most decorated Olympian of all time.

Winning a competition and getting a gold medal means a lot but setting a world record also means a lot. It means more to be able to hold it for several years. Michael Phelps has been holding the 200M fly record since 2009, which means 10 years.

Phelps’ record was set at the 2009 World Championships in Rome, when he finished in 1:51.51. It was a drop of three seconds over eight years. source

Kristóf Milák, the 19 year old Hungarian swimmer set a new record a couple of days ago, he clocked in at 1:50.73, shaving .78 seconds off Phelps’ time.

It is a huge achievement for the young Hungarian, he made history and now the whole World knows his name. But fame is not everything, now he has to live up to the expectations. No pressure, right?

Phelps was not happy about it but he had a very diplomatic answer when asked how does he feel about it. He said he's frustrated (I can understand that) but he couldn't be happier to see how he did it. Kristóf Milák could be happy as Phelps said the last 100m was was incredible. This is a great appreciation from the legend.

Milorad Čavić broke the 100m record in 2009 and Phelps took it back the next day. It's funny how these guys break record after record.
